Don't go here for repairs! They will mess up your ...
Don't go here for repairs! They will mess up your bike so that there's more for them to fix on it. I know three people plus myself who have had bad experiences with them changing tires. They were not careful with the specialty paint on the wheels and caused dents in the wheel itself. They may be awesome at selling motorcycles, but fixing, not so much.